John produced six times as many books as his brother. If their difference in production is 15, how many books did his brother produce

Respuesta :

texaschic101
texaschic101 texaschic101
  • 04-01-2018
J = 6B
J - B = 15

6B - B = 15
5B = 15
B = 15/5
B = 3 <=== the brother produces 3 books

J = 6B
J = 6(3)
J = 18.....and John produces 18
